Listening

Understanding before replying.

Restating

Summarise what you heard before answering. It confirms understanding, and it shows the other person they were heard, which lowers the temperature.

  • Ask open questions and let pauses run.
  • Notice the concern behind the objection, which is often unstated.

Common failures

Preparing your rebuttal while listening, finishing sentences, and answering a question nobody asked. All three feel efficient and lose information.
